Hardware keyboards are going away because they add bulk, cost, & complexity to making a phone. The bigger screens make soft-keyboards easy to use, plus you can do swiping and it's easier to customize different languages for the manufacturers. A lot of people I know who used to swear by HW keyboards, have converted just fine to using soft-keyboards.
